Abstract
In switching elements each using a two-terminal-type variable resistance element, improper writing or any improper operation is often caused and the reliability of the switching elements cannot be improved easily. A switching element according to the present invention is equipped with a first variable resistance element equipped with a first input/output terminal and a first connection terminal, a second variable resistance element equipped with a second input/output terminal and a second connection terminal, and a rectifying element equipped with a control terminal and a third connection terminal, wherein the first connection terminal, the second connection terminal and the third connection terminal are connected to one another.
